LOW SEVERITY

CVE-2014-0228

Hive vulnerability

CVSS
3.5
EPSS
3.5%
EPSS pct
88th
Exploited
No known
Apache Hive before 0.13.1, when in SQL standards based authorization mode, does not properly check the file permissions for (1) import and (2) export statements, which allows remote authenticated users to obtain sensitive information via a crafted URI.
Affected vendor
Apache
Affected product
Hive
CVSS vector
AV:N/AC:M/Au:S/C:P/I:N/A:N
Weakness type (CWE)
  • CWE-284 — Improper Access Control
Published
2014-11-16

Risk analysis

Based on its CVSS vector, this vulnerability is exploitable over the network, medium attack complexity, requiring single-factor authentication. Successful exploitation leads to partial impact to confidentiality.

Its EPSS score of 3.5% reflects a lower probability of exploitation activity in the wild over the next 30 days, placing it above 88% of all scored CVEs.
